Installing an SFP
Install an SFP to provide an interface between the switch and the network cable.
Installing an SFP takes about three minutes.

Prerequisites
• Verify that the SFP is the correct model for your network configuration.
• Before you install the optical connector, ensure it is clean.
Warning:
Risk of eye injury by laser
Fiber optic equipment can emit laser or infrared light that can injure your eyes. Never look into
an optical fiber or connector port. Always assume that fiber optic cables are connected to a light
source.
Electrostatic alert:
Risk of equipment damage
To prevent damage from electrostatic discharge, always wear an antistatic wrist strap
connected to an ESD jack.
Caution:
Risk of equipment damage
Only trained personnel can install this product.
Procedure steps
1. Remove the SFP from its protective packaging.
2. Grasp the SFP between your thumb and forefinger.
3. As shown in the following figure, insert the device into the slot on the module.
Caution:
Risk of equipment damage
SFPs are keyed to prevent incorrect insertion. If the SFP resists pressure, do not force it;
turn it over, and reinsert it.
Apply a light pressure to the device until it clicks and locks into position.
